How Do You Know When It’s Time?

Here are seven key signs that knee replacement surgery may be the right next step:

  1. Persistent Pain That Limits Daily Life: If pain prevents you from walking, climbing stairs, or sleeping comfortably—even with medication—it may be time to consider surgical intervention.
  2. Stiffness or Limited Mobility: Trouble bending or straightening your knee despite therapy could signal joint degeneration.
  3. Swelling That Doesn’t Improve: Chronic inflammation, even with rest and ice, may indicate structural joint damage.
  4. Mechanical Symptoms: If you experience grinding, locking, or popping in your knee, this could suggest advanced arthritis or meniscus injury.
  5. Failed Conservative Treatments: If physical therapy, injections, and medications no longer help, it may be time to explore replacement options.
  6. Visible Deformity: A bowing or inward turning of the knee joint may indicate joint misalignment from cartilage loss.
  7. Advanced Arthritis Diagnosis: X-rays showing bone-on-bone contact or severe cartilage damage are strong indicators for surgery.
